Granta Park, set in the countryside south of Cambridge, is the leading research park in the Cambridge sub-region and places all of Pfizer’s global drug delivery device expertise under one roof. The cutting-edge site comes complete with purpose-built labs, engineering facilities and plenty of office space. The building is a celebration of the success of the devices group, and is designed to encourage continuous improvement in the way Pfizer delivers medicines to patients.
As part of the 'Biotech Boom' in the Cambridge area, Granta Park has developed as a key location for companies working in the healthcare field. Other companies on the site include UCB, Gilead, Cambridge Antibody Technology and Alizyme.
About the area
One of the busiest tourist spots in the country with over three million visitors a year, Cambridge is also famously home to one of the world's most prestigious universities, which is itself a source of much of that tourism and only a short drive away from Granta Park. With some colleges dating back to the eleventh century and all forms of architecture represented, Cambridge is a jewel to anyone interested in British history. For those of you interested in social and leisure activities, the theatres, bars and restaurants of the city are only a short distance away too.
